Wine Spectator's tasting notes for the 2014 vintage
On the occasion of the Bordeaux Primeurs 2014, here is a series of scores awarded by some of the most influential tasters in the world of classified Bordeaux wines.
Top 12 best-rated Bordeaux En Primeur wines of 2014
First, let's begin by the 12 castles, including the highest-rated ones : their maximum scores are the highest, with a variation between 99 and 98 out of 100.
It should be noted that the Great Sauternes are performing well in the rankings as well as Haut-Brion red and white and the great Pomerols. 2014 is a vintage of terroir that respects the hierarchy.

The wines of Saint-Estèphe
Cos d'Estournel has dropped out of the rankings, while very beautiful notes were allocated to the Castles Calon-Ségur 2014, Phélan-Ségur, Capbern and Les Ormes de Pez. These rather high scores reflect an almost perfect ripening of the Cabernet Sauvignon in this northern part of the Médoc.
